Pain Screening in the Older Adult With Delirium
Joy R Goebel1, Michelle Ferolito2, Nicholas Gorman3
1School of Nursing, California State University Long Beach, Long Beach, California.
Background:
In patients with cognitive impairments who are unable to self-report pain, nurses must rely on behavioral observation tools to assess and manage pain. Although frequently employed in medical-surgical units, evidence supporting the psychometric efficacy of the Pain in Advanced Dementia (PAINAD) for pain screening in older adults with delirium is lacking.
Aim:
To examine the psychometrics of the PAINAD for older adults with delirium in medical-surgical settings.
Design:
A descriptive repeated measures design.
Setting:
Medical-surgical units in an urban tertiary care hospital.
Participants:
Sixty-eight older adults with delirium.
Methods:
Patients with delirium unable to self-report pain were screened by two data collectors with the PAINAD and the Critical Care Pain Observation Tool (CPOT). Patients with a PAINAD score ≥3 or a CPOT score ≥2 received a pain intervention. Pain assessments were repeated 30 minutes post baseline or pain intervention.
Results:
Patients were predominately female (58.8%) with dementia (71%). Thirty-nine patients screened positive for pain and received a pain intervention. PAINAD reliability was strong (Cronbach's α = 0.81-0.87; interrater intraclass coefficients [ICC] = 0.91-0.94; test-retest ICC = 0.76-0.77). Construct validity was supported by a statistically significant interaction effect between time (baseline versus follow-up) and condition (pain intervention versus no pain group; Rater 1: F(1,66) = 8.31, p = 0.005, ηp2 = 0.11; Rater 2: F(1,66) = 8.22, p = 0.006, ηp2 = 0.11.
Conclusions:
The PAINAD is a reliable and valid tool for pain screening for older adults with delirium in medical-surgical settings.
Clinical Implications:
Pain and delirium frequently co-occur in the older adult population. Best practices require a holistic assessment for contributing pain and non-pain factors in patients exhibiting distress.
